A 57-year-old female asked:
Why is my platelet count 481, ive never had a problem but today i was low on potassium and sodium?

Iron deficiency is a common cause of elevated platelet count. You may take oral iron supplement and repeat the test in 6 months or so. In isolation, your platelet count is not a concern.

Platelet count varies a lot and we are more concerned when the count is very high persistently. The upper normal of platelet count is 450K so your number is not too far off. Low Na and K with a healthy person not taking any medication should be repeated. However, thiazide diuretic is the most common cause if you are taking this med for hypertension.
